3x3, 1x3, 2x2, 1x2 Couplers 3x3, 1x3, 2x2, 1x2 Couplers

Couplers can be used to split light from one or more fibers onto two or three fibers or to combine light from two or three fibers onto one or more fibers. Depending on the transmission system the light can be at one or many wavelengths in the range 1250nm to 1600nm. For different systems couplers of the following types are available.

Single Wavelength Coupler:
Insertion Loss specified for operation at a single wavelength in the range from 1250nm to 1600nm.

Wavelength Flattened Coupler:
Designed to give uniform insertion loss over a broad wavelength band around a centre wavelength of 1310nm or 1550nm.

Dual Wavelength Coupler:
Designed to give a uniform insertion loss over the complete wavelength band from 1260nm to 1600nm.
